Turkey’s Spor Toto Super League side Eskişehirspor is set to play against Scotland’s Saint Johnstone in the second qualifying round of The UEFA Europa League on July 19 unless the Court of Arbitration for Sports (CAS) lifts a ban on Beşiktaş.
Eskişehirspor qualified to take part in the Europa League after UEFA barred Beşiktaş from European competitions for one year for misleading the European football organization about its finances. The İstanbul team has appealed the UEFA decision at the CAS and a final decision is expected on July 5. Eskişehirspor Chairman Halil Ünal said at a press conference on Monday that his club is getting ready for the game as if they will definitely be there.
